Robin EH09 and EH12-2 engines were commonly installed in vibratory rammers and other construction machinery where compact dimensions, dependable starting and reliable operation under vibration were essential. Correct servicing is particularly important in rammer applications because the engine may be exposed to dust, repeated shock loading and demanding working conditions.
Using the correct service information can help reduce repair errors, avoid unnecessary replacement of serviceable components and ensure that important measurements, clearances, adjustments and tightening procedures are completed correctly.

Troubleshooting and fault diagnosis
The manual provides structured guidance for investigating common engine faults. These may include failure to start, difficult starting, unstable running, lack of power, overheating, excessive oil consumption, abnormal engine noise, misfiring or poor fuel economy.
A systematic troubleshooting procedure helps identify whether a fault is related to the fuel system, ignition system, compression, lubrication, governor operation, starting system or internal engine wear.
Correct diagnosis can save workshop time and help prevent unnecessary replacement of components that remain serviceable.

Carburettor and fuel-system servicing
The Robin EH09 EH12-2 Rammer Workshop Manual includes technical procedures for servicing the carburettor and associated fuel-system components.
Workshop information may include carburettor removal, dismantling, cleaning, inspection, adjustment and reassembly. Blocked jets, contaminated fuel, incorrect float settings or air leaks can cause difficult starting, unstable operation and loss of engine power.
Correct carburettor servicing is important for reliable starting, smooth acceleration and stable running under changing loads.
Ignition-system inspection
The ignition section provides guidance for inspecting and testing components such as the spark plug, ignition coil, flywheel and associated wiring.
A weak, intermittent or incorrectly timed spark can cause poor starting, misfiring or complete failure to run. The manual helps technicians inspect the ignition system in a logical sequence.
Spark-plug condition and gap, ignition-coil performance and electrical connections should all be checked carefully during diagnosis.
Governor and throttle controls
The governor system regulates engine speed as the operating load changes. The manual includes service and adjustment information for the governor mechanism, throttle linkage and control system.
Correct governor adjustment is especially important after carburettor removal, linkage repair or engine dismantling. Incorrect settings may cause unstable running, poor load response or excessive engine speed.

Manual details:
Manufacturer: Robin Engines
Models covered: EH09 and EH12-2
Application: Rammer engines
Manual type: Workshop service and repair manual
Publication number: PUB-ES1330
Revision: December 2001
Number of pages: 84
Language: English
Format: Digital PDF manual
